原标题:"excel四舍五入和取整怎么操作" 相关电脑设置教程分享。 - 来源:191路由网。我们在使用excel处理数据的时候总是会遇到四舍五入或者取整的时候,那么今天就来说一下其中
将格式化的时间值四舍五入到最接近的半小时 - | 我需要0:30到0:59向下舍入到0:30。
我需要0:00到0:29才能舍入到0:30。
示例:08:56将舍入到08:30,其中09:00和09:01将需要舍入到09:30。
秒应省略或四舍五入为:00
我想使用javascript验证一个四舍五入到2位的文本框 - ||| 我想验证一个四舍五入到小数点后两位的文本框。但是,我不想四舍五入。
例如;如果我输入19.999,则结果将是19.99,而不是20.00
如果我输入19.7,则结果将是19.70。如果我输入19,则结果将为19.00
toFixed()函数...
在PHP中四舍五入小数 - | 我想显示一个数字作为获胜百分比,类似于您在ESPN棒球排名中看到的数字。如果用户没有损失,我希望该百分比读数为1.000。如果用户没有获胜,我希望它显示为.000。如果用户是赢家还是输家,我想显示.xyz,即使y或y和z为0。
这段代码使我没有尾随...
四舍五入到最接近的0.05值的问题 - | 已经有很多关于此的问题。
一个流行的答案是使用以下公式。
Math.ceiling(myValue * 20) / 20
我需要以下输出作为相应的输入。
16.489 (input) - 16.49(output)
使...
将十进制值四舍五入到最接近的0.05值? - | 我正在阅读如何将十进制值四舍五入到最接近的0.05值?
它提到以下内容。
Math.ceiling(myValue * 20) / 20
这个骇客如何运作?我的意思是我们是如何得出这个解决方案的?
四舍五入的目标C问题 - | 将计算结果四舍五入到小数点后两位有问题。
这是一个财务计算,当结果涉及半分钱时,我希望这个数字会被四舍五入,但实际上已经被四舍五入了。
复制问题:
float raw = 16.695;
NSLog(@\"All DP: %f\",raw);
...
四舍五入除以2的幂 - | 我正在从教科书中实现量化算法。我的工作很正常,除了四舍五入时出现一个错误。这是教科书必须说的:
可以通过将偏移量和右移p位位置来对“ 0”进行舍入除法
现在,我对正确的转变有所了解,但是他们在谈论什么偏移呢?
这是我的示例代码:
de...
将Objective-C浮点数四舍五入至最接近的.05 - || 我想将以下浮点数四舍五入到最接近的0.05。
449.263824-> 449.25
390.928070-> 390.90
390.878082-> 390.85
我该怎么做?
有效的BigDecimal四舍五入到小数点后两位 - || 在Java中,我试图找到一种有效的方法来根据条件将BigDecimal舍入为两位小数,即Up或Down。
IF condition true then:
12.390 ---> 12.39
12.391 ---> 1...
1.表达式对x进行四舍五入保留n位小数:(Math.round(x * 10^n) / (10^n)).toFixed(n);10的n次方在这里写成10^n只是为了方便表达,js中应该使用Math.pow(10,n)或1en。2.解释Math.round:把一个数字
GNU bash,版本4.2.24: $> printf "%.0f, %.0f\n" 48.5 49.5
48, 50 Ruby 1.8.7 > printf( "%.0f, %.0f\n", 48.5, 49.5 )
48, 50 Perl 5.12.4 $> perl -e 'printf( "%.0f, %.0f\n", 48.5, 49.5 )'
48, 50 gcc 4.5.3: >
1,直接截去小数部分转换成整数 使用强制转换会将浮点部分去除,把整数部分转换为整数。 1 var i = Int (23.50) //23 2,四舍五入转换成整数 lroundf是一个全局函数,作用是将浮点数四舍五入转为整数。 1 var i = lroundf(23.50) //24
给所有的double类型扩展一个新方法. extension Double {
func roundTo(places: Int) -> Double {
let divisor = pow(10.0, Double(places))
return (self * divisor).rounded() / divisor
}
} 这样就可以像这样使用
参考来源:http://ebreezee.itpub.net/post/23931/470549 方法1: int n=3;//例如取小数位3位 double a=1.1234567; int index = a.ToString().IndexOf(".");//取小数点所在位置索引 if (index + 1 + n > a.ToString().Length|| a.ToString().I
'********1*********2*********3*********4*********5*********6*********7********** '*: Description: 丸め処理 '*: Argments: d = 原データ '*: FLG = 丸め区分(0:切り捨て 1:四捨五入 2:四捨五入) '*: M = 小数の桁数 '*
1,格式化显示,如:122,则显示为122.00 textbox1.text=Format(Convert.ToDecimal(textbox1.text),"0.00") 2,小数点四舍五入,如,3.12634精确小数点后2位,则显示为3.13 TextBox2.Text = System.Math.Round(Val(Trim(TextBox1.Text)), x) 此处用到
Module Module1
Sub Main()
Dim d1, d2, d3 As Double
d1 = 1.234
d2 = 1.345
d3 = 1.456
'-----------------------四舍六入-----------------------------
VB.NET经过长时间的发展,很多用户都很了解VB.NET了,这里我发表一下个人理解,和大家讨论讨论。在VB.NET要做到四舍五入的功能应该用VB.NETFormat这个函数,用CInt或CLng都只能取到整数部分,而用VB.NET Format函数可以取到你所指定的小数位数。 Public Function Round(numAsVariant,nAsLong) As String
Ro